Analysis of CQI Traces from LTE MIMO Deployments and Impact on Classical SchedulersAs a second contribution of the paper, we analyze the performance of classical schedulers (i.e., Round Robin, Best CQI and Proportional Fair) under the obtained LTE MIMO channel conditions. Specifically, we analyze the impact of the channel feedback reporting rate in scenarios with multiple greedy sources.作者: 浪蕩子 時(shí)間: 2025-3-23 19:52

AntWMNet – A Hybrid Routing Algorithm for Wireless Mesh Networks Based on Ant Colony Optimisation propose a hybrid wireless mesh networks routing algorithm that addresses the referred problems, exploring the ant colony optimisation paradigm. The algorithm, named AntWMNet, was extensively studied through simulation using OMNET++, and the results show that it clearly outperforms the reference AODV algorithm.作者: needle 時(shí)間: 2025-3-27 15:11 作者: 擁擠前 時(shí)間: 2025-3-27 18:12
